Mobile service has a way of exposing both ability and gaps. A store can hide a lot with lifts, lighting, and controlled conditions. The curb, the driveway, the shoulder of a county road, they expose habits. When a mechanic brings the workshop to you, safety becomes a noticeable, disciplined routine rather of an indication on the wall. This is where trust is either earned or lost. The procedures listed below come from years of crawling under vehicles in weather condition that doesn't care, detecting fuel leaks in cramped garages, and saying sorry to next-door neighbors for early-morning impact gun sound. They're composed for chauffeurs who wish to know what "safe" appears like, and for any mobile mechanic who wants to run a tighter operation.
There's no lift with mechanical locks, no fixed exhaust extraction, and usually no service manager double-checking paperwork. Street grades differ. Lighting may be a dull deck bulb or severe midday sun. You're closer to pedestrian traffic, blown dust, open drains, and curious family pets. Even an oil change has added variables: where to put the waste oil, how to catch wind-borne drips, how to keep a jack on a sloped paver without crushing a brick.
The approach that works is not a smaller sized version of store procedure. It is a field protocol, modular and repeatable, created to recognize the threats of a specific spot and shape the task around them. A good mobile mechanic treats the area as part of the repair.
The most safe jobs begin 10 minutes before the toolbox opens. I start by stalling and looking. Grade, surface type, drainage, overhead clearance, and traffic patterns all matter. Concrete with a minor crown acts differently than interlocking pavers. A crowned asphalt driveway can let a wheel chock sneak if you don't set it snug against the tire. If the driveway slopes toward the street, placing the car so the front deals with uphill secures you when lifting a front corner.
Weather gets a fast projection check even on clear days. Afternoon squalls turn brake dust into paste and can make power tools slick. Wind above 15 mph suffices to take a plastic oil drain bag and fling it across a yard. Extreme heat increases the odds of coolant scalds and tool slips, and cold includes brittle plastics and delayed brake fluid bleed rates. If a thunderstorm impends, electrical diagnostics under a hood become a bad option. Some tasks can wait.
Space matters more than owners realize. If the chauffeur's side has 18 inches to a fence, it might be fine for a battery swap, however it will turn a control arm task into a contortion act that welcomes bad utilize. When space is tight, I ask to move trash bins, bikes, or the car itself. It conserves time and spares knuckles.
Finally, I prepare an exit route for both the lorry and myself. It sounds odd up until you deal with a seized ball joint that suddenly releases or a pipe clamp that finally releases and soaks the floor. Knowing where you can step without tripping over a climber or a tube keeps a problem from becoming an injury.
It is tempting to avoid protective equipment on quick jobs. That habit is how corneal abrasions, hearing loss, and chemical burns sneak in. A practical baseline consists of impact-rated shatterproof glass, nitrile gloves, and ear protection. The brand matters less than consistency. I keep three sets of glasses: clear, tinted for sunlight, and anti-fog for cold mornings. I switch them as easily as I change sockets.
Gloves have to do with matching the task. Thin nitrile is perfect for electronics and interior work where feel is vital. Durable nitrile or neoprene is better for coolant and brake fluid. Mechanics' gloves with knuckle guards conserve skin when wrestling exhaust hangers or crowbar. Insulated gloves only come out for EV battery isolation or high-voltage cable television examinations, and they are constantly coupled with lockout treatments and a voltage tester.
Respiratory security earns its location in more jobs than the majority of people believe. Brake dust still includes all sorts of particulates that shouldn't be in lungs. A simple P100 filter is low-cost insurance coverage. For fuel system operate in tight garages, I use a half-mask with natural vapor cartridges and established cross-ventilation. The mask goes on before the fuel line is split, not after the fumes hit.
Footwear is another peaceful safety call. Oil-resistant soles, reinforced toes, and stability on gravel make a difference. I discovered this the tough method, stepping onto a patch of transmission fluid on smooth pavers in the very first minute of a task. One slide, one dinged up quarter panel, one awkward discussion. Now I lay absorbent mats before I pop the pan bolts.
A creeping cars and truck with a gradient of two degrees will win whenever. Wheel chocks reside in the top of the drawer for a factor. Difficult rubber, not wood wedges. They go on both sides of a wheel when I lift an axle, and on the downhill side when I lift one corner. I choose chocks with a rope handle so I do not need to reach under the bumper blind.
Parking brakes ready, then evaluated by carefully rocking the automobile. Automatic transmissions go in Park, manuals in first or reverse depending upon slope. On some trucks with weak parking brake shoes, I add a secondary chock on the opposite axle as insurance coverage. You find out which designs are suspicious. Older Tacomas and Rangers have taught me not to trust ignored cable adjusters.
Jacks lift, stands hold. That's not a slogan, it's a rule. Hydraulic floor jacks, even the good ones, bleed off. I match stands to the vehicle weight, then set them under solid points: frame rails, pinch welds with jack pad blocks, subframe installs. If the surface area is soft, I include steel plates under the stands. Plywood flexes, steel does not. On pavers, I avoid joints and set the plates throughout bricks to spread the load.
Before going under, I press the car laterally on the stands. A little controlled wobble is safer than a surprise shift. If the stands move or creak, I reset them. I never count on a jack alone, and I constantly move a minimum of one wheel and tire under the rocker as a last line of defense. It has never needed to do its task, and I plan to keep it that way.
People worry about spills for environmental factors and because they don't desire spots on the driveway. A mobile mechanic stress over both, plus the danger of ignition. I set absorbent pads under any connection most likely to weep. For oil and coolant, a wide-mouth drain pan is standard, however the trick is pre-aligning it with cardboard guides to capture that very first hot surge. Transmission fluid loves to take a trip along crossmembers, so a second pan under the member conserves your day.

Open flames have no location near cars, yet ignition sources still exist. Generators spark internally when stopping working, battery terminals arc when tools bridge them, and catalytic converters remain hot long after a drive. I bring 2 fire extinguishers: one 2.5 pound ABC unit on my belt clip and a 5 lb in the van. They get checked quarterly, not when they start rattling. I also keep a wool fire blanket for small flare-ups in tight spaces, which beats dousing an interior with powder.
Fuel system opening is where the discipline matters. I always depressurize at the Schrader valve or by pulling the fuel pump relay and running the engine until it stalls. The rag over the valve is not optional. Throughout line disconnects, fuel-rated caps go on right away. I never lay an open line next to a battery, and I keep the catcher pan grounded if I'm using an electrical transfer pump. Easy actions, big difference.
Ventilation is non-negotiable. Garages trap fumes. If I'm working indoors, the garage door is open, a box fan sits at the limit burning out, and a second fan pulls fresh air from the back. For battery charging or welding, I leave more area still. Which brings us to electricity.
Most lorries can bite at 12 volts if the amperage exists, and a wrench across a battery can bond itself faster than you can pull your hand away. I tape wrench manages and keep a battery terminal cover on the terminal I'm not working. Unfavorable disconnect first, reconnect last. If memory settings matter, I utilize a memory saver through the OBD port after validating it will not energize circuits required to be isolated.
High-voltage hybrids and EVs require training and regard. Even if you're just replacing brake pads, you can't assume the regenerative system will remain asleep. The orange cables are apparent, however the module logic isn't. I follow the maker's isolation procedure, verify no voltage with a FELINE III tester, and implement a no-tool zone over high-voltage elements. Insulated tools are a layer, not a plan.
I learned to treat capacitors as packed up until tested otherwise. Some systems hold charge long after power-down. Waiting the suggested interval, often 5 to 10 minutes, feels like loafing, however it avoids the worst mistakes. If a job falls outside my mobile scope, such as opening a battery pack or detecting an inverter, I refer it. That recommendation is a security choice, not a capability confession.
Proper torque is not almost wheel lug nuts. Drain pipes plugs, caliper bracket bolts, trigger plugs in aluminum heads, all are worthy of the best value. Over-torque can crack a pan, under-torque can cause a leakage that ruins a driveway and a day. I bring 3 torque wrenches: a 3/8 inch for 10 to 80 ft-lb, a 1/2 inch approximately 250 ft-lb for axle nuts and wheels, and an inch-pound wrench for fragile work. Calibration is examined annually. If a torque spec isn't convenient, I utilize manufacturer service information or trusted databases, not guesswork.
Jack points and engine support rigs require appropriate placement. For subframe bushing tasks, I utilize a spreader beam with correct chains, not a 2x4 throughout fenders. Fenders dent and crush. For suspension work, I imitate trip height when torquing control arm bushings to avoid preloading rubber at complete droop. That avoids squeaks and early failure. These information sound like finesse, however they are safety. Parts that stop working since they were installed wrong fail under load, which is when individuals are under or near the vehicle.
The website is not a laboratory, yet tidiness still pays. I set a tidy zone for eliminated parts so nothing gets kicked into yard or gravel. Magnetic trays capture fasteners, and a tarp under the engine bay captures anything slippery. Tools return to the cart after usage. This is not about neatness points, it has to do with preventing a misplaced 13 mm from becoming a wheel chock substitute.
Noise procedures matter when the shop is a cul-de-sac. Impact guns are short and during reasonable hours. If a task needs late work, I ask approval and switch to hand tools when possible. It keeps the peace and lowers rushed mistakes.
Waste handling is a credibility test. Utilized oil, coolant, solvent rags, and brake dust bags enter into identified containers in the van. I reveal the customer the labels if they ask. The majority of communities accept used oil and filters at designated sites. Ethylene glycol coolant need to not end up in a storm drain. If you see a mobile mechanic washing coolant off a driveway with a pipe, do not employ that person again.
The safest jobs have clear expectations. If I arrive and the owner hasn't discussed that the automobile leaks fuel overnight, the threat profile changes. I go back and re-scope the job. That may mean rescheduling, or moving the vehicle to a more secure spot. Similarly, if the wheel lock essential disappeared, I do not hammer sockets onto locks while the cars and truck sits on a slope. The discussion takes place before force, not https://s3.us-east-2.amazonaws.com/fairfield-bay-ar-mechanic/fairfield-bay-ar-mechanic/uncategorized/mobile-mechanic-tire-solutions-repairs-rotations-and-more.html after damage.
When parts remain in question, I bring spares or validate compatibility with VIN. Going back to the parts keep mid-job increases the odds of hurried reassembly. If I find a secondary fault, like a torn serpentine belt throughout a generator swap, I document it with photos and offer a strategy. I never ever stack unintended deal with top of a task if it compromises security. If the owner desires whatever done now, the job may relocate to a different day.
For road-side breakdowns, I collaborate with the motorist about dangers. Danger triangles head out at set ranges, reflective vest on, and the work happens on the side far from traffic whenever possible. If the shoulder is insufficient, towing off the highway beats changing a tire in the lane. No repair is worth playing tag with traffic.
There is a line where mobile work stops making good sense. Press-fit wheel bearings without a portable press can be done with specialized kits, however it is easy to crossthread or misseat if you combat the lorry on unequal ground. Exhaust manifold studs that have actually merged into the head are better drilled on a lift with space and regulated heat. Transmission overhauls, cylinder head resurfacing, chassis welding, and ADAS radar calibrations all tilt towards a controlled environment.
A professional mobile mechanic is specified as much by the jobs they decline as the ones they accept. I keep a list of relied on stores and provide warm handoffs. Clients remember that you protected their car and your group, not that you didn't grab every dollar.
Summer heat suggests burns from radiators and catalytic converters. I keep silicone tube pinch-off pliers to separate hot coolant circuits and give engines a longer cool-down window when possible. Winter season brings stiff circuitry utilizes that crack if bent strongly, and breakable plastic clips that shatter. Warm the location, not simply your hands. A small heat gun or perhaps a pocket warmer next to a persistent clip conserves time and prevents future rattles.
Rain is a diplomatic immunity. Water turns brake rotors into knives for fingers. It likewise turns the ground into a conductor if you're using corded tools. If I can't keep the work dry and electrics secured, I stop. A canopy tent helps, however wind can turn it into a sail. Whatever that increases in a driveway needs to be anchored or it becomes a hazard.
Quick penetrating can cause sly damage. Back-probing connectors with stitching needles develops corrosion courses. I utilize proper back-probe pins and avoid piercing insulation unless the repair work plan includes sealing and protective loom. When removing adapters, I depress the correct tab. Breaking tabs in the field typically leads to zip-tie "repairs" that stop working in time and create future security issues.
On cars with start-stop systems and delicate voltage management, I deploy a steady power supply throughout module updates. Voltage dips throughout programs can brick modules and create dangerous states like inoperative ABS or guiding assist. If the power supply can not be safely set up on-site, that programs waits for a shop.
Good consumers make safe work easier. Clearing area around the vehicle, keeping family pets and kids indoors, and supplying precise history all improve results. If the vehicle simply came off a long highway run, anticipate a cool-down buffer. If the last repair involved stripped lug nuts or aftermarket lift sets, say so. Your mechanic will bring the ideal thread chasers and torque data.
Owners likewise manage scheduling. If you need the automobile in one hour, do not book a task with unknowns. The rushed state of mind breeds errors. A lot of mobile mechanics can use time windows that represent parts runs and unforeseen deterioration. Ask for honest estimates and plan around them.
You can frequently judge a mechanic's security culture before the hood opens. A clean, arranged van or truck with identified bins. PPE on the individual, not stuffed under a seat. Wheel chocks released before jacks roll. Absorbent pads and drip trays ready, not fetched after the first spill. A torque wrench that sees real use, not simply photo ops. Paperwork or digital kinds that include task scope, VIN, and permission, not simply a handshake.
The disposition matters too. A professional narrates simply enough to keep you notified, not to flaunt. They decrease when conditions change. They stop, reassess, and explain if the plan shifts. That calm is a practical safety tool. When the employee is calm, the process remains within tolerance.
Oil filter double-gasketed and delegated blow out on start-up. That takes place when somebody hurries and does not inspect that the old gasket came off. My routine consists of a finger sweep of the mounting surface area and a look in the old filter.
Battery terminals left loose since somebody used pliers instead of a 10 mm with a torque specification. I tighten up to producer spec and twist-test the terminal.
Suspension bolts torqued at complete droop. If you tighten control arm bushings with the suspension hanging, the rubber will twist at ride height and fail early. I either support the center to ride height before torque or surface torque on the ground with a low-profile wrench.
Brake lines twisted throughout caliper replacement. Keeping a bungee on the caliper and lining up the banjo bolt with fresh washers prevents a line from becoming a spiral.
Wheel nuts hammered on with an effect and left at 200 percent of torque. Effects are useful to seat, torque wrenches end up the task. If studs are stretched or threads feel gritty, I chase them or suggest replacement.
A last examination is not a success lap, it becomes part of the repair work. I check for hanging wires, forgotten tools, and fluid routes. Hood locks get a manual pull test. For brake tasks, a fixed pedal test comes first, then a low-speed roll with duplicated stops to seat pads and validate no pulls. Guiding wheel centering gets attention after any suspension work. Tire pressures are set and kept in mind; it's remarkable how often a low tire masquerades as a suspension noise.
I take images of essential actions: torque readings on vital fasteners, the changed parts, and any watched conditions such as seepage that didn't justify a replacement today. These go into the invoice. Good records are a safeguard for both parties. If something feels off later, we have a timeline and data, not guesswork.
Trustworthy mobile services bring general liability and garage keeper's coverage tailored for mobile operations. That way, if something unforeseeable occurs, the consumer isn't counting on goodwill. Local business licenses and compliance with hazardous waste policies are part of the plan. Ask, and a pro will reveal proof without flinching.
Certifications are a signal, not an assurance. ASE badges and manufacturer training tell you someone has actually purchased learning. The real requirement is consistency. You recognize it in the same chocks, the same PPE, the same image documentation, the same measured rate, job after job.
A mobile mechanic is successful by making the unchecked feel managed. Not by luck, however by small, constant routines: chocks before jacks, stands before climbers, specifications before torque, stops briefly before prying, fans before fumes. Customers do not require to memorize every procedure, but they should acknowledge the rhythm. When a professional takes those extra steps without excitement, that's the trust you can lean on. Security isn't a separate task contributed to the task. It is the approach itself, from the first glimpse at the slope of the driveway to the last check of the hood latch.
